Sketch the region enclosed by the graphs of x = 0, 6y – 5x = 0, and x + 3y = 21. Find the area. Find the volume of the solid formed when the region is revolved around the y-axis.
x=0 --> this is the equation for y-axis 6y-5x = 0 --> this is a straight line (choose two points and draw a line throught hem) x+3y=21 --> another straight line.

area is correct.
volume bye disc method: \[ V=\pi\int_{y=0}^5\left({5\over 6}y\right)^2dy+\pi\int_5^7(21-3y)^2dy \]
